I use this program to convert movies (all formats, RM/QT/Divx/etc) for all my devices, ipod/iphone/DS/PSP/GBA. It's really fast too. I think it's the best converter out there and thought I'd share it with you guys. If anyone knows PERL, you can write plugins to convert pretty much every device known to man (MP4/DPG/PMP).

ezbuilder

It's a very simple command line application but really well written. All I do is put the videos I want to convert into the MediaFile Folder and run ezbuilder.

Instructions from website:

1. Copy the videos you want to convert into the MediaFile folder.

2. Then run ezbuilder.exe.

3. Choose the target you want.

When your file is converted, it should show up in the DoneFile directory.

Ezbuilder needs the following software (It needs system codec for directshow reading)

1. Avisynth 2.5.6a (or higher version) http://www.avisynth.org

2. For converting rm / rmvb , please install Real Alternative

Free-Codecs.com :: Download Real Alternative 1.75 : Real Alternative will allow you to play RealMedia files without having to install RealPlayer/RealOne Player

3. For converting Quicktime file type clip , please install QuickTime Alternative

Free-Codecs.com : QuickTime Alternative 2.5.1 : QuickTime Alternative will allow you to play QuickTime files (.mov, .qt and other extensions) without having to install the official QuickTime Player.

4. Suggest installing K-Lite Mega Codec Pack (it has Quicktime and Real codecs already!)

Free-Codecs.com :: Download K-Lite Mega Codec Pack 3.9.0 : The K-Lite Mega Codec Pack includes the K-Lite Codec Pack Full, QuickTime Alternative, Real Alternative support and Monkey's Audio DirectShow decoder.

Another thing you can do is to use is "hardlinks"

Sometimes I need to convert gigs and gigs of video for my DS/iPod/Play Yan. However, you have to “copy” or “move” the video into the “MediaFile” folder which takes time and lots of extra HD space. By using “Hardlinks”, you don’t have to copy/move them there at all. You just make a symbolic link to the file. Not a shortcut but a link so that programs will think it’s actually in that directory when it’s not. NTFS supports this and is very useful.
